## Changelog — Font vendoring defaults changed

As of this release, the Bracken UI build no longer fetches third-party fonts at build time. All typefaces used by the Lanternwell suite are now vendored into the repo under a dedicated assets directory, and the fetch step is skipped by default. If you're onboarding, nothing to install — the fonts travel with the checkout. The build flags controlling this behavior are listed below.

settings of hadup-yafog:
LAMAEL_PIN=3761
LAMAEL_TENANT=istmir
LAMAEL_METRICS_HOST=metrics.lamael.plorvasys.test
LAMAEL_SEAL=seal_8ea68500
LAMAEL_STANDBY_TEAM=fraok

14:22 — Flaky Coinloom integration tests strike again. Settlement suite went red, then green on rerun, classic. Turns out the mock bank stub leaks a port between runs, so parallel shards collide. On-call doesn't need to page anyone; just rerun with shards=1 until the stub fix merges tonight. The offending run's trace token is below.

pipeline stamp: htk3_69f

// Broker upgrade notes for plugin authors:
// Quillbus 4.x replaces the legacy 3.x wire protocol. Plugins must
// construct the client with explicit protocol negotiation enabled,
// or connections to the Larkfield cluster will be silently downgraded
// and dropped after 30s. Topic names are unchanged. For local testing
// against the sandbox broker, authenticate with the key below.

API key for bafof-bagaf: qvz2-qi